Hats Off to Belk Whether they gobbled ice cream until their lips were numb or groped their blind- folded way through an obstacle course, dorm residents and faculty members alike had a chance to test their talents in compe- titions of an unusual kind, beginning at 3:30 on the afternoon of April 18. The place was the dormitory quadrangle, and the event was an annual tradition presented by the Resident Assistants. It was Derby Day. The competitions opened with the Sand- and-Spoon Relay, with the faculty team scooping their way to victory. Belk residents rolled their way to a first-place finish in the “Toilet Paper Relay,” and Wallace’s Caro- lyn Dattalo proved especially adept at “Shaving a Balloon.” As the games contin- ued, the competition grew intense; but the Belk team fought back from the faculty’s wins in the beer-guzzling and ice-cream- eating contests to win the tug-of-war and the obstacle course — and first place over- all. After the games ended, Derby Day com- petitors enjoyed a picnic in the dorm quad. The R.A.s were proud of their effort to get people involved in the fun; as Terri Small- wood said, “There was a lot of participation this year.” 26 Derby Day
